Rhodblock 6 is a Rho kinase (ROCK) inhibitor that inhibits phospho-MRLC (myosin regulatory light chain) localization.
Rhodblock 6 (1-30 μM) inhibits ROCK activity robustly and in a dose-dependent manner. Rhodblock 6 also inhibits its human ortholog, ROCK I, and Rhodblock 6 (100 μM; 20 h) causes the disruption of stress fibers in human HeLa cells[1].
